SHANGHAI, Jun. 4 (SMM) – SHFE 1506 aluminum contract retreated from RMB 13,000/mt on Thursday afternoon, sending spot aluminum in south China down as well. Downstream buyers sat tight, in anticipation of lower prices and due to tight cash. Mainstream traded prices were RMB 12,980-12,990/mt.
